League Rules — T-Ball
Players can be 3 to 5 years old but not turn 6 before April 20, 2026.
Field: Bases 50 ft. Double base at first. Pitcher takes position at 45' from home plate. Ball must travel 15 feet to be fair.
Equipment: T-Adjustable. Batting helmets provided by players at parents' discretion.
Ball: Incrediball-type soft baseball.
- Game is 4 innings or 60 minutes; no new inning after 55 minutes.
- Every player hits off the batting tee. No pitching.
- No walks or strikeouts.
- All players play defense — 5 in the infield, extras in the outfield.
- All players bat on offense.
- Ball must travel 15 feet when hit to be fair.
- No extra-base hits; players advance 1 base when the ball is put in play.
- No stealing.
- All outs are force-outs.
- No sandals. All defensive players need a glove/mitt.
League Rules — Coach Pitch Division
Players can be 5 to 7 years old but cannot turn 8 before April 30, 2026.
- 60-foot bases.
- Pitcher at 45' from home plate. Ball must travel 15 feet to be fair.
- Coach pitches from within the circle drawn around the 45' mound.
- Continuous batting order. Ten players play on the field.
- Play is dead when the pitcher controls the ball with both feet inside the circle.
- Batter and all base runners must wear helmets.
- No new inning after 55 minutes or 6 innings. Games can end in a tie.
- A batter receives 5 pitches or 3 strikes. No walks.
- Teams may use a catcher (in full gear) or not.
- Infield-fly rule not in effect.
- One offensive and defensive time-out per inning.
League Rules — 8U Rookies Division
- Pitching distance: 44 feet. Bases: 60 feet.
- Continuous batting order — all players bat.
- Rookies can play with 9 or 10 in the outfield. 4 outfielders on the grass.
- Players can only sit out two innings in a row.
- No lead-offs. Runners may steal once the pitched ball passes home plate.
- No new inning after 1 hour 40 min or 6 innings. 5 runs max per inning.
- No metal spikes. Approved USSSA bats allowed. No balks.
- Pitchers: 3 innings per game max.
- Courtesy runner for pitcher or catcher anytime — must be last batted out.
- No run rule (just 5 runs max per inning).
- Automatic out on a dropped/missed third strike.
League Rules — 9U to High School
- Teams can bat 9, 10, or whole lineup.
- No new inning after 1 hr 40 min or 6 innings (7 for 13U+), or DROP DEAD at 2 hours for Pool play.
- Games can end in a tie if tied after 6 innings (7 for 13U+).
- 5 runs max per inning. Less than 20 minutes left: umpires declare an open inning.
- Run rules:
- 6-inning game: 15 after 3 | 8 after 4
- 7-inning game: 15 after 3 | 12 after 4 | 8 after 5
- USSSA-approved bats. USA bats allowed.
- Metal spikes not allowed at BLD Manteca or Mistlin Fields Ripon.
- 3rd-ball dropped strike is played.
- Courtesy runner for pitcher or catcher anytime.
- Pitchers: 3 innings per game for 14U/15U-A and younger.
- Distances: 46/65 (9U–10U), 50/70 (11U–12U), 54/80 (13U), 60/90 (14U+).
- Players must play 4 games to be eligible for playoffs.
- All players on USSSA roster; only 1 team per season.
League Rules — 13U 54/80 and Older
All rules above apply, plus:
- No metal spikes at BLD Manteca or Mistlin Fields Ripon.
- Pitchers: 3 innings per game for 13U and 14U/15U-A.
- High School Division: no pitching limit set by us — managers should use discretion and never overpitch players.
